Key Sectors

Information Technology
Information Technology is considered among the promising sectors in Jordan as well as a gateway to opening up the country socially and economically. The government has, therefore, adopted a general policy based on taking all necessary practical actions to guarantee the development of this sector to enable it to compete on an international level, attract local and international investments, create exceptional job opportunities and provide export returns as well as whatever profits might be made… more

Pharmaceutical
The pharmaceutical industry sector is witnessing a noticeable development in view of the use of scientific methods and modern technology and the availability of qualified human resources in the field of manufacturing medicines. Pharmaceutical exports are second only to the garments industry, positioning it as the first true leading industry in Jordan. It also has the ability to attract large amounts of foreign investment in the field of research and development because of its ability to meet the commitments of intellectual property rights…. more

Tourism
This sector contributes positively to supporting the Jordanian economy in view of the number and variety of sites of natural, religious, historical and health interest, for Jordan is characterized by a rich heritage as represented by the large number of world-known tourist sites like Petra, Amra Desert Palace, Wadi Rum, the Dead Sea and the Baptism Site in addition to more than 27 thousand discovered and registered historical sites…more

Apparel & Textiles
The manufacture of materials and ready-to-wear clothes is considered one of the main industrial sectors in Jordan. This sector has witnessed huge growth and a large flow of investments as the value of clothes exports during the year 2004 was around 927 million Dollars, an increase of 61% compared to the year 2003. Since the signing of the Qualified Industrial Zones Agreement, the amount of investments in this sector rose to 835 million Dollars up to the end of 2004. This helped to provide job opportunities and to provide Jordan with high export returns…more

Mining and Downstream Industries
The mining sector plays a large role in the Jordanian economy as it represents the main part of the proceeds from Jordanian exports
despite the limited mineral resources of the country. For example, Jordan is considered one of the largest exporters of phosphates in the world…more
